Cleaning-crew access — Felbrook House. The contracted crew from Silverbroom Services works 22:00 to 02:00, Monday through Friday. Night shift should admit them via the loading-bay entrance only and confirm the crew roster against the facilities sheet. They have no access to the server room or level five. The loading-bay door takes the code below.

door code, yagap-bahof: bdg-O-05

## Break-Glass: Bulk Edits in the Quillbase Admin Table

Heads up for reviewers: bulk edits in the Quillbase admin table are normally gated behind two-person approval. When that flow is broken (yes, it happens), the break-glass path lets a single on-call admin push the change. It logs everything and pages the security channel automatically. To unlock the break-glass console, you'll enter the recovery passphrase shown directly below.

vault phrase of hawif-bahof = novvan-belius-istael-fenvan-holdor-druox-eliath

### Runbook: Pictogrove Image Cache Memory Leak

If heap usage on a render node climbs steadily past 70%, the Pictogrove image cache is likely retaining evicted thumbnails. Restart the cache worker, not the whole node, and confirm heap returns to baseline within ten minutes. Record the incident against the leaking build using the trace token below.

session token of tajef-bageg = htk21_5d90d574934f3ccae6437

## Authentication

Heads up: the nightly reindex job (`reindex_nightly.py`) talks to the Lanternfish search cluster, and that cluster won't accept anonymous writes anymore — we locked it down last sprint. The job now authenticates as the `reindex-runner` service identity against Corvid Gateway, and the token is injected via the `LF_INDEX_TOKEN` env var in the scheduler config. Nothing clever going on, just a bearer header on every batch request. For review purposes, the staging credential currently in use is listed below.

service key, kadug-kadup: kto15_rN23XLAYImmZgrJ